use leetcode::list::*;
impl Solution {
pub fn merge_two_lists(list1: Option<Box<ListNode>>, list2: Option<Box<ListNode>>) -> Option<Box<ListNode>> {
let mut p1 = &list1;
let mut p2 = &list2;
let mut result: Vec<i32> = vec!();
loop {
let v1: i32;
let v2: i32;
match p1 {
None => {
match p2 {
None => break,
Some(px) => {
result.push(px.val);
p2 = &px.next;
continue;
}
}
},
Some(p1) => { v1 = p1.val; },
}
match p2 {
None => {
match p1 {
None => break,
Some(px) => {
result.push(px.val);
p1 = &px.next;
continue;
}
}
},
Some(p2) => { v2 = p2.val; },
}
if v1 <= v2 {
result.push(v1);
p1 = match p1 {
Some(px) => &px.next,
None => p1,
};
} else {
result.push(v2);
p2 = match p2 {
Some(px) => &px.next,
None => p2,
};
}
}
vector2list(result)
}
}
struct Solution {}
fn main() {
println!("{:?}", list2vector(
Solution::merge_two_lists(vector2list(vec!(1,3,5)),
vector2list(vec!(2,4,6)))));
}
